EAST INDIA SHIPPING.

.The 'Algeria° Sloop of War arrived at St. Helena, on the 10th February, with orders for the detention of all Dutch vessels which may touch there. The Dartmoor and Marco Rozzaris, from Batavia, have already been seized.

The Moffat, Cromarty„ from London to China, pat into Singapore on the 6th November with loss of main and mizzen-masts. and other damage sustained daring a gale which she encountered in the China seas from the 22d to 26th November., The Mary, Dobson, from Bengal to Liverpool, put into the Minditius on the I.8th December dismasted, and with her cargo much damaged. The Ocean Queen. from Mauritius to London, put into the Cape on the 20th January with loss of foremast. Ste. The Company's Ships Abercrombie Robinson, and London, from China, encountered a severe and sudden gale, near the Azores, on the 31st March.' The farmer ship lost her mizzen-mast and maintopmast. The latter cut away her topgallant-masts.
